Parol Evidence Rule
A rule in contracts law that prevents parties from presenting extrinsic evidence of terms of the contract that contradict, modify, or vary contractual terms written in the contract document.
Oral Evidence
Testimony or statements spoken out loud in court as opposed to written evidence.
Statute of Frauds
A legal principle requiring certain types of contracts to be in writing to be enforceable.
United States Code
The comprehensive, codified collection of the permanent general and special laws of the United States federal government.
